Solve for g
9.4 - ( 2 divided by g) = 7.4

To solve the equation \( 9.4 - \frac{2}{g} = 7.4 \), follow these steps:

1. Start by isolating the term with \( g \) on one side. Subtract 7.4 from both sides:

\[
9.4 - 7.4 - \frac{2}{g} = 0
\]

Simplifying gives:

\[
2 - \frac{2}{g} = 0
\]

2. Next, move \( \frac{2}{g} \) to the right side:

\[
2 = \frac{2}{g}
\]

3. To eliminate the fraction, cross-multiply:

\[
2g = 2
\]

4. Divide both sides by 2:

\[
g = 1
\]

Thus, the value of \( g \) is \( \boxed{1} \).
